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,232 in Phuket versus $1,715 in Quimper.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,255 in Phuket versus $2,620 in Quimper.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,279 in Phuket versus $3,526 in Quimper.

Living in Phuket costs roughly 28% less than in Quimper, driven mainly by Eating Out.

The two cities straddle the global median: Phuket is 8% below, Quimper is 28% above.
